Web ad networks give marketers a new option: one-stop shopping can take the guesswork out of buying

Article Abstract:

The growing popularity of the World Wide Web as a business-to-business advertising tool has spurred the development of web advertising networks. These networks are responsible for selling advertising space for a group of web site marketers. Aside from simplifying the process of ad buying for many marketers, web advertising networks also assume the responsibility for maintaining and upgrading websites.

Intranet, provider surge to spur online spending

Article Abstract:

Internet service providers are expected to increase their business-to-business (B-to-B) advertising spending in 1996 in conjunction with the anticipated increase in intranet usage. Among the major service providers, America Online spent the largest amount on B-to-B advertising in 1995. The company doled out $84 million in advertising funds to promote its Enterprise product to business clients.
